[QUOTE="lefty15, post: 150828, member: 6516"] Both my buddy and I shot 168 Barnes x Triple shocks last year in our .300 win mags. We had excellent results on whitetail & mule deer from about 75 yards to 350 yards, and cow elk at about 350-450 yards with perfect expansion. Both my buddy and I have shot 180gr Accu bonds & ballistic tips in our .300wm's and had terrible results with both bullets. So far the Barnes x triple shocks have had the best results & accuracy for my buddy & I, and also Barnes x triple shocks to not foull my barrel like the Noslers. [/QUOTE]
